Автоматизация в Stationeers - это не просто прокладывание проводов между консолями и устройствами. Это в первую очередь инженерное планирование. Без четкой структуры даже простая система вентиляции может привести к катастрофе на базе. Чтобы избежать превращения своей станции в запутанный клубок проблем, придерживайтесь системного подхода.
Этап 1: Проектирование логики
Не спешите расставлять логические вентили и соединять кабели. Начинайте с бумаги или текстового файла. Внятный алгоритм - залог успеха.
- Цель: Определите, что именно должна делать система (например, поддерживать температуру в теплице).
- Ресурс: С каким параметром вы работаете? (Давление газа, температура, количество энергии в аккумуляторе).
- Датчики: Какие приборы будут считывать показатели? (Сенсоры давления, термометры).
- Исполнительные механизмы: Что будет менять состояние системы? (Насосы, обогреватели, вентиляторы).
- Логика действий: Составьте четкую связку: «Если показатель X ниже Y, включить устройство Z».
Этап 2: Обработка условий и исключений
После того как базовая схема готова, нужно добавить «защиту от дурака» и критические сценарии. Самые частые ошибки новичков - игнорирование экстремальных ситуаций.
- Диапазон срабатывания (Гистерезис): Никогда не ставьте точечное значение включения и выключения (например, при температуре 20 градусов). Система будет постоянно щелкать реле, что приведет к перегреву кабелей. Всегда задавайте коридор: «Включать при 18°, выключать при 22°».
- Приоритеты: Что важнее - сохранить кислород или электричество? В критических ситуациях автоматика должна иметь ветку для аварийного отключения второстепенных потребителей.
- Безопасность: Добавьте проверку «защиты от отказа». Если датчик вышел из строя или показатели ушли в нереалистичный диапазон, система должна уходить в безопасный режим, а не продолжать работать с неверными данными.
Этап 3: Практическая реализация
Когда логика утверждена, переходите к сборке.
- Изоляция сетей: Старайтесь не объединять логические сети без необходимости. Если одна логическая цепь начнет сбоить, изолированная архитектура не даст ошибке распространиться на всю базу.
- Маркировка: Используйте Labeler на всех кабелях и устройствах. Через 10 часов игры вы не вспомните, что делает этот конкретный логический контроллер, если он не подписан.
- Тестирование: Всегда проводите проверку на тестовом стенде, прежде чем подключать сложную автоматику к системе жизнеобеспечения. Смоделируйте резкое изменение условий и посмотрите, как отреагирует контроллер.
Итог
Автоматизация - это итеративный процесс. Сначала вы создаете простое решение для поддержания стабильности, а затем постепенно усложняете его, добавляя новые датчики и условия. Главное правило: не пытайтесь автоматизировать всё сразу. Сначала добейтесь идеальной работы одной подсистемы, и только потом связывайте её с остальной сетью.


Комментариев пока нет.